More about the book
The narrative explores Alain Mabanckou's journey from Congo to France, reflecting on his experiences and the profound changes he encounters upon returning after 25 years. It delves into themes of identity, nostalgia, and the passage of time, highlighting the contrasts between his past and present. The book captures the emotional weight of memory and the complexities of belonging, offering a unique perspective on cultural and personal transformation.
